Transaction 122e577ce4fd85a7948988dea91f010491e67230a17ae296a14c7f3c6795c853
1 Input
1 Output
-
122e577ce4fd85a7948988dea91f010491e67230a17ae296a14c7f3c6795c853:0
- value
- 66500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3048139882b2f46691127b1b9304b1304fea62e1 OP_EQUAL
- address
- 366JhiazN2iZfVKQgExCzZrBqzRmnRC6Y1